And the MAF screen isnt there to protect the sensor wire. It's a laminar diffuser for stabilizing and smoothing the air so the MAF can get accurate readings. The air filter protects the wire element. On a high boost turbo application however damage can happen. But on forced induction the MAF screen isn't very restrictive.
